gpt4 book ai didi

c# - 使用 linq to sql 求和列

转载 作者:太空狗 更新时间:2023-10-29 22:11:34 24 4
gpt4 key购买 nike

我有一个 DataView,我想在其中对一个名为“Amount”的列求和

现在我知道我可以遍历列并获得总和,但我想知道是否可以使用 Linq to Sql?

String sum = Linq to Sql 这里的东西(不一定是字符串,可以是任何类型)

谢谢,罗查尔

最佳答案

假设 Amount 列是 double (可以是另一种类型)

double sum = Table.Select(t => t.Amount ?? 0).Sum();

或者

double sum = Table.Sum(t => t.Amount ?? 0).Sum();

如果 t.Amount 为 null,则使用 null coelescing 运算符将为您提供默认值 0。

关于c# - 使用 linq to sql 求和列,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/1744673/

24 4 0
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号
广告合作:1813099741@qq.com 6ren.com